The invention relates to the technical field of power batteries, in particular to a discharge allowable power control method and device, a vehicle and a medium, and the method comprises the steps: obtaining the minimum monomer voltage of a power battery at the current moment; if the lowest monomer voltage of the power battery at the current moment is smaller than a preset under-voltage threshold value, the actual discharging power of the power battery at the moment when the lowest monomer voltage of the power battery starts to be smaller than the preset under-voltage threshold value and the lowest monomer voltage of the power battery at the previous moment are obtained; according to the lowest monomer voltage of the power battery at the current moment and the lowest monomer voltage of the power battery at the previous moment, the voltage change trend and the voltage change quantity of the lowest monomer voltage of the power battery are calculated, so that the target change rate of the discharge allowable power of the power battery at the current moment is determined; and controlling the allowable discharge power of the power battery according to the actual discharge power and the target change rate. Therefore, the problems of power limitation caused by over-discharge of the battery and sudden change of vehicle power and the like in the prior art are solved.
